Generate tests for a completed phase based on UAT criteria and implementation

SKILL.md

1.1 KB, as published. Nobody here has run it

<objective> Generate unit and E2E tests for a completed phase, using its SUMMARY.md, CONTEXT.md, and VERIFICATION.md as specifications.

Analyzes implementation files, classifies them into TDD (unit), E2E (browser), or Skip categories, presents a test plan for user approval, then generates tests following RED-GREEN conventions.

Output: Test files committed with message test(phase-{N}): add unit and E2E tests from add-tests command </objective>
